Some of you may know that Andrea Roche lost the licence for Miss Universe Ireland and now she has been replaced by Miss Indiana USA 2008, Brittany Mason. Now I know in 2015 I made a big hoopla about Rozanna Purcell taking over, and I was very disappointed with the results. But, I think this is different. At least, I hope it is. Ms. Mason genuinely seems to care about this pageant and trying to give Ireland a serious chance.
I have been the Ambassador for the Republic on Misso for 2 years now, and I have had to make do with only ever dealing with the Miss Ireland pageant (Not complaining, love the Org. and how great they are with Miss World) but Miss Universe is the pageant I most care about. And I have had to watch as other nations get regionals, preliminary competitions and photoshoots, whilst Ireland gets a casting, if even.
Looking at the new website, (Yes, Miss Universe Ireland has a website now! - http://missuniverseireland.eu/),it all seems legit. The pageant is set for August, 2017 and most importantly, it lists the duties the new Miss Universe Ireland is expected to undertake, including philanthropic duties.
